Many people are concerned about the visual effects of the installation of solar panels on their home. While the greatest focus should be placed on the money that can be saved, as well as the environmental impact, it is normal to be concerned about visual elements as well.
The majority of installations are on the back side of the roof, which limits visibility to passersby. Though they do not sit completely flush with the roof, they are not high enough to appear odd or out of place. The number of panels that are used will depend on how much energy needs to be generated for your home to function normally.
Though the wiring that is needed is minimal, the wiring that does exist will be well hidden. Professional installers make sure that all visual elements are well taken care of. After the installation is complete, it will not be long before you forget that the panels are even there. They will simply become one of the part of your daily life.
As the number of homes that make use of solar PV panels continues to increase, these will soon be the norm in neighborhoods everywhere. The curb appeal of your living space will always be important. However, rest assured that the use of solar energy is very wise, and panels are not at all unattractive.
